Explanation / Answer

1) From first law of thermodynamics

Change in internal energy= Q+W

Q and W are +Ve if added to the system

Change in internal energy= 285+115= 400 joules

2) For a constant pressure process

work done = -nR ( T2-T1), n= number of moles of gas

R= 8.314 Joule/mole.K T2=125 deg.c T1= 0 deg.c

Work done = -2.5*8.314*(125-0) =-2538. 125.

Heating at constant pressure leads to expansion of gas and gas does work
